目录全文检索match query匹配查询multi_match query 多字段查询match_phrase query短语查询query_string querysimple_query_stringbool query布尔查询highlight高亮自定义高亮html标签多字段高亮全文检索 全文检索查询(Full Text Queries)
一 序 本文属于极客时间Elasticsearch核心技术与实战学习笔记系列。 本节继续介绍es的基本概念。因为pdf没有下载,所以就是对着码字,或者视频截个图。二 分布式 elasticsearch其实就是一个分布式系统,需要满足分布式系统具备的高可用性和可扩展性2.1分布式系统的可用性与扩展性高可用性
服务可用性-允许有节点停止
ElasticsearchElastic Stack 的核心 Elasticsearch 是一个分布式、RESTful 风格的搜索和数据分析引擎,能够解决不断涌现出的各种用例。 作为 Elastic Stack 的核心,它集中存储您的数据,帮助您发现意料之中以及意料之外的情况。 &n
转载
2024-07-19 14:13:11
31阅读
给ElasticSearch引擎配置慢查询日志,可以实时监控搜索过慢的日志。虽然ElasticSearch以快速搜索而出名,但随着数据量的进一步增大或是服务器的一些性能问题,会有可能出现慢查询的情况。慢查询日志可以帮助你快速定位到是什么 Index 和 语句 过慢。甚至还可以用Opster Search Log Analyzer分析你的慢查询日志,Opster Search Log An
转载
2024-03-20 07:04:44
161阅读
1. 查询 term查询term 查询是代表完全匹配,搜索之前不会对你搜索的关键字进行分词,直接拿 关键字 去文档分词库中匹配内容查询语句:POST /sms-logs-index/sms-logs-type/_search
{
"from": 0, # 类似limit,指定查询第一页
"size": 5, # 指定一页查询几条
"que
转载
2024-02-17 12:29:27
191阅读
文章目录前言文档类API集群管理API_cat系列allocationshardsmasternodeshealthshardsindices_cluster系列healthstatsstatepending_taskssettingreroutenodes_nodes系列 前言Elasticsearch作为非关系型数据库,在某种程度上和关系型数据库相似,作为数据库,我们的主要作用就是存储数据、
转载
2024-03-22 16:20:18
566阅读
_search含义_search查询返回结果数据含义分析GET _search{
"took": 1,
"timed_out": false,
"_shards": {
"total": 16,
"successful": 16,
"failed": 0
},
"hits": {
"total": 19,
"max_score": 1,
文章目录1、查询分配未分配的原因1.1 问题场景描述1.2 诊断方式1.3 解决方案1.4 所有 12 种分片未分配原因汇总2、查询集群的健康状况2.1 健康状态2.2 查看状态信息3、查看集群中所有节点的节点属性3.1 常见使用场景4、查看集群中所有节点的分配信息4.1 常见使用场景5、查询集群/索引的文档总计数5.1 常见使用场景6、查询集群的分片分配信息6.1 常见使用场景6.2 使用案例7
转载
2024-05-21 15:47:44
147阅读
ES系列:查看Master API
原创
2021-09-11 16:49:47
475阅读
://192.168.40.148:9200/_cat/master?v
原创
2022-03-09 11:11:37
110阅读
curl基本用法-X 指定http的请求方法有 HEAD GET POST PUT DELETE
-d 指定要传输的数据
-H 指定http请求头信息
-u参数用来设置服务器认证的用户名和密码。
-k参数指定跳过 SSL 检测。
-L参数会让 HTTP 请求跟随服务器的重定向。curl 默认不跟随重定向。
-o参数将服务器的回应保存成文件,等同于wget命令。
$ curl -o example.
原创
2024-04-22 16:37:56
77阅读
7.mapping 类型映射设置查看ES索引结构相当于 create table , 设置 数据类型7.1.操作7.1.1._mapping 查看索引GET /bank/_mapping显示 类型{
"bank" : {
"mappings" : {
"properties" : {
"account_number" : {
"type"
转载
2024-03-28 19:19:13
31阅读
# Android中查看所有的tasks
在Android开发中,一个task是指应用程序的一个实例,包含了应用程序的所有活动。在Android系统中,可以通过以下方式查看所有的tasks,以便更好地了解应用程序的运行状态和管理任务栈。
## 查看所有的tasks的方法
在Android系统中,可以使用ActivityManager来获取所有的tasks信息。ActivityManager是
原创
2024-05-09 03:21:26
157阅读
一、Term Index(词项索引)1、FSM(Finite State Machine)有限状态机2、FSA(Finite State Acceptor)确定无环有限状态接收机3、FST(Deterministic acyclic finite state transducer)确定无环状态转换器二、Term Dictionary(词项字典)三、Posting List(倒排表)1、FOR(F
转载
2024-07-30 11:56:33
107阅读
ES 在搜索上对外开放了 Resultful API, 方便各个语言调用,那么他调用有两种方式,一种就是单纯将搜索的参数放到url上,还有就是可以放到Request Body里面,我们来依次看看。URL Search 路由携带参数搜索GET movies/_search?q=love&df=title&sort=year:asc&from=0&size=10
{
转载
2024-04-13 11:42:03
95阅读
文章目录初步检索一、_cat二、put&post新增数据三、get查询文档四、put/post修改数据六、删除文档&索引七、样本测试数据 初步检索一、_cat#为jmeter返回的结果#127.0.0.1 70 73 1 0.09 0.09 0.06 dilm * f5d627bec026
GET /_cat/nodes 查看es节点信息
#1677563347 05:49:
转载
2024-03-05 10:47:36
2863阅读
://192.168.40.148:9200/_cat/aliases?v&pretty
原创
2022-03-09 11:10:22
272阅读
http://192.168.40.148:9200/_cat/aliases?v&pretty
原创
2021-09-12 10:15:41
3291阅读
在Kubernetes(K8S)集群中,要查看Elasticsearch(ES)集群的任务队列,需要通过API来实现。这个过程可能对于刚刚入行的开发者来说具有一定的挑战性,但只要按照正确的步骤进行,就可以轻松完成。接下来,我将通过以下步骤指导你如何查看ES集群任务队列API。
流程概述:
| 步骤 | 操作 |
|-------|--
原创
2024-05-06 11:03:56
87阅读
...
转载
2021-07-22 20:09:00
174阅读
2评论